We have plesk running on a dedicated box that hosts our website and a few others.

Now all seems to work fine but i cannot ping ns1.superserver.co.uk or ns2.superserver.co.uk


  • ftp.superserver.co.uk. CNAME superserver.co.uk.
    mail.superserver.co.uk. A 217.146.91.225
    ns.superserver.co.uk. A 217.146.91.225
    ns1.superserver.co.uk. A 217.146.91.225
    ns1.superserver.co.uk. NS ns1.superserver.co.uk.
    ns2.superserver.co.uk. A 217.146.91.230
    ns2.superserver.co.uk. NS ns2.superserver.co.uk.
    superserver.co.uk. A 217.146.91.225
    superserver.co.uk. MX (10) mail.superserver.co.uk.
    superserver.co.uk. NS ns1.superserver.co.uk.
    superserver.co.uk. NS ns2.superserver.co.uk.
    webmail.superserver.co.uk. A 217.146.91.225
    www.superserver.co.uk. CNAME superserver.co.uk.

is our DNS settings. are they correct?

According to http://www.dnsreport.com:

WARNING: At least one of your nameservers did not return your NS records (it reported 0 answers). This could be because of a referral, if you have a lame nameserver (which would need to be fixed).

217.146.91.230 returns 0 answers (may be a referral


any help is appreciated

First, clean up your DNS entries.

Remove the following:

ns1.superserver.co.uk. NS ns1.superserver.co.uk.
ns2.superserver.co.uk. NS ns2.superserver.co.uk.

Since they are incorrect.

Restart bind and retest locally. You may need to wait for the DNS to repropagate for the links from dnsstuff to work.

Also, make sure your firewall has the DNS ports open.
